import sys
from typing import Any, Optional, Union
if sys.version > "3":
basestring = str
from pyspark import SparkContext
from pyspark.sql import Column, DataFrame, SparkSession
from pyspark.storagelevel import StorageLevel
from graphframes.lib import Pregel
def _from_java_gf(jgf: Any, spark: SparkSession) -> "GraphFrame":
"""
(internal) creates a python GraphFrame wrapper from a java GraphFrame.
:param jgf:
"""
pv = DataFrame(jgf.vertices(), spark)
pe = DataFrame(jgf.edges(), spark)
return GraphFrame(pv, pe)
def _java_api(jsc: SparkContext) -> Any:
javaClassName = "org.graphframes.GraphFramePythonAPI"
return (
jsc._jvm.Thread.currentThread()
.getContextClassLoader()
.loadClass(javaClassName)
.newInstance()
)
class GraphFrame:
def __init__(self, v: DataFrame, e: DataFrame) -> None:
self._vertices = v
self._edges = e
self._spark = v.sparkSession
self._sc = self._spark._sc
self._jvm_gf_api = _java_api(self._sc)
self.ID = self._jvm_gf_api.ID()
self.SRC = self._jvm_gf_api.SRC()
self.DST = self._jvm_gf_api.DST()
self._ATTR = self._jvm_gf_api.ATTR()
# Check that provided DataFrames contain required columns
if self.ID not in v.columns:
raise ValueError(
"Vertex ID column {} missing from vertex DataFrame, which has columns: {}".format(
self.ID, ",".join(v.columns)
)
)
if self.SRC not in e.columns:
raise ValueError(
"Source vertex ID column {} missing from edge DataFrame, which has columns: {}".format( # noqa: E501
self.SRC, ",".join(e.columns)
)
)
if self.DST not in e.columns:
raise ValueError(
"Destination vertex ID column {} missing from edge DataFrame, which has columns: {}".format( # noqa: E501
self.DST, ",".join(e.columns)
)
)
self._jvm_graph = self._jvm_gf_api.createGraph(v._jdf, e._jdf)
@property
def vertices(self) -> DataFrame:
return self._vertices
@property
def edges(self) -> DataFrame:
return self._edges
def __repr__(self):
return self._jvm_graph.toString()
def cache(self) -> "GraphFrame":
self._jvm_graph.cache()
return self
def persist(self, storageLevel: StorageLevel = StorageLevel.MEMORY_ONLY) -> "GraphFrame":
javaStorageLevel = self._sc._getJavaStorageLevel(storageLevel)
self._jvm_graph.persist(javaStorageLevel)
return self
def unpersist(self, blocking: bool = False) -> "GraphFrame":
self._jvm_graph.unpersist(blocking)
return self
@property
def outDegrees(self)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.outDegrees()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
@property
def inDegrees(self)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.inDegrees()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
@property
def degrees(self)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.degrees()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
@property
def triplets(self)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.triplets()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
@property
def pregel(self):
return Pregel(self)
def find(self, pattern: str)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.find(pattern)
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def filterVertices(self, condition: Union[str, Column]) -> "GraphFrame":
if isinstance(condition, basestring):
jdf = self._jvm_graph.filterVertices(condition)
elif isinstance(condition, Column):
jdf = self._jvm_graph.filterVertices(condition._jc)
else:
raise TypeError("condition should be string or Column")
return _from_java_gf(jdf, self._spark)
def filterEdges(self, condition: Union[str, Column]) -> "GraphFrame":
if isinstance(condition, basestring):
jdf = self._jvm_graph.filterEdges(condition)
elif isinstance(condition, Column):
jdf = self._jvm_graph.filterEdges(condition._jc)
else:
raise TypeError("condition should be string or Column")
return _from_java_gf(jdf, self._spark)
def dropIsolatedVertices(self) -> "GraphFrame":
jdf = self._jvm_graph.dropIsolatedVertices()
return _from_java_gf(jdf, self._spark)
def bfs(
self, fromExpr: str, toExpr: str, edgeFilter: Optional[str] = None, maxPathLength: int = 10
) -> DataFrame:
builder = (
self._jvm_graph.bfs().fromExpr(fromExpr).toExpr(toExpr).maxPathLength(maxPathLength)
)
if edgeFilter is not None:
builder.edgeFilter(edgeFilter)
jdf = builder.run()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def aggregateMessages(
self,
aggCol: Union[Column, str],
sendToSrc: Union[Column, str, None] = None,
sendToDst: Union[Column, str, None] = None,
) -> DataFrame:
# Check that either sendToSrc, sendToDst, or both are provided
if sendToSrc is None and sendToDst is None:
raise ValueError("Either `sendToSrc`, `sendToDst`, or both have to be provided")
builder = self._jvm_graph.aggregateMessages()
if sendToSrc is not None:
if isinstance(sendToSrc, Column):
builder.sendToSrc(sendToSrc._jc)
elif isinstance(sendToSrc, basestring):
builder.sendToSrc(sendToSrc)
else:
raise TypeError("Provide message either as `Column` or `str`")
if sendToDst is not None:
if isinstance(sendToDst, Column):
builder.sendToDst(sendToDst._jc)
elif isinstance(sendToDst, basestring):
builder.sendToDst(sendToDst)
else:
raise TypeError("Provide message either as `Column` or `str`")
if isinstance(aggCol, Column):
jdf = builder.agg(aggCol._jc)
else:
jdf = builder.agg(aggCol)
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
# Standard algorithms
def connectedComponents(
self,
algorithm: str = "graphframes",
checkpointInterval: int = 2,
broadcastThreshold: int = 1000000,
useLabelsAsComponents: bool = False,
) -> DataFrame:
jdf = (
self._jvm_graph.connectedComponents()
.setAlgorithm(algorithm)
.setCheckpointInterval(checkpointInterval)
.setBroadcastThreshold(broadcastThreshold)
.setUseLabelsAsComponents(useLabelsAsComponents)
.run()
)
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def labelPropagation(self, maxIter: int)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.labelPropagation().maxIter(maxIter).run()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def pageRank(
self,
resetProbability: float = 0.15,
sourceId: Optional[Any] = None,
maxIter: Optional[int] = None,
tol: Optional[float] = None,
) -> "GraphFrame":
builder = self._jvm_graph.pageRank().resetProbability(resetProbability)
if sourceId is not None:
builder = builder.sourceId(sourceId)
if maxIter is not None:
builder = builder.maxIter(maxIter)
assert tol is None, "Exactly one of maxIter or tol should be set."
else:
assert tol is not None, "Exactly one of maxIter or tol should be set."
builder = builder.tol(tol)
jgf = builder.run()
return _from_java_gf(jgf, self._spark)
def parallelPersonalizedPageRank(
self,
resetProbability: float = 0.15,
sourceIds: Optional[list[Any]] = None,
maxIter: Optional[int] = None,
) -> "GraphFrame":
assert (
sourceIds is not None and len(sourceIds) > 0
), "Source vertices Ids sourceIds must be provided"
assert maxIter is not None, "Max number of iterations maxIter must be provided"
sourceIds = self._sc._jvm.PythonUtils.toArray(sourceIds)
builder = self._jvm_graph.parallelPersonalizedPageRank()
builder = builder.resetProbability(resetProbability)
builder = builder.sourceIds(sourceIds)
builder = builder.maxIter(maxIter)
jgf = builder.run()
return _from_java_gf(jgf, self._spark)
def shortestPaths(self, landmarks: list[Any])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.shortestPaths().landmarks(landmarks).run()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def stronglyConnectedComponents(self, maxIter: int)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.stronglyConnectedComponents().maxIter(maxIter).run()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def svdPlusPlus(
self,
rank: int = 10,
maxIter: int = 2,
minValue: float = 0.0,
maxValue: float = 5.0,
gamma1: float = 0.007,
gamma2: float = 0.007,
gamma6: float = 0.005,
gamma7: float = 0.015,
) -> tuple[DataFrame, float]:
# This call is actually useless, because one needs to build the configuration first...
builder = self._jvm_graph.svdPlusPlus()
builder.rank(rank).maxIter(maxIter).minValue(minValue).maxValue(maxValue)
builder.gamma1(gamma1).gamma2(gamma2).gamma6(gamma6).gamma7(gamma7)
jdf = builder.run()
loss = builder.loss()
v = D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
return (v, loss)
def triangleCount(self) -> DataFrame:
jdf = self._jvm_graph.triangleCount().run()
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
def powerIterationClustering(
self, k: int, maxIter: int, weightCol: Optional[str] = None
) -> DataFrame:
if weightCol:
weightCol = self._spark._jvm.scala.Option.apply(weightCol)
else:
weightCol = self._spark._jvm.scala.Option.empty()
jdf = self._jvm_graph.powerIterationClustering(k, maxIter, weightCol)
return DataFrame(jdf, self._spark)
